1. 什么是人工智能状态机?
人工智能状态机是一种有限状态自动机,它由一组状态、转移条件和转移动作组成。状态表示了人工智能的内部状态,转移条件表示了人工智能在何种条件下会从一个状态转移到另一个状态,转移动作表示了人工智能在状态转移时所采取的行为。
2. 人工智能状态机的实现原理
人工智能状态机的实现原理主要包括以下几个方面:
(1)状态表示:人工智能状态机的状态可以用一个向量或一个标量表示,向量可以表示多个状态,标量只能表示一个状态。
(2)状态转移条件:人工智能状态机的状态转移条件可以是一组逻辑条件或一个函数,逻辑条件可以是多个条件的组合,函数可以是一个映射。
(3)转移动作:人工智能状态机的转移动作可以是一个函数或一个动作序列,函数可以是一个映射,动作序列可以是多个动作的组合。
3. 人工智能状态机的应用场景
人工智能状态机可以应用于多个领域,如游戏开发、机器人控制、自动驾驶等。在游戏开发中,可以用状态机来描述游戏角色的行为,如攻击、防御、逃跑等。在机器人控制中,可以用状态机来描述机器人的行为,如巡逻、搜寻、抓取等。在自动驾驶中,可以用状态机来描述车辆的行为,如加速、减速、转弯等。
人工智能状态机是一种重要的人工智能数学模型,它可以帮助我们更好地理解人工智能的决策过程和行为表现。在实际应用中,人工智能状态机具有广泛的应用场景和应用前景,可以为我们创造更加智能化和高效的生产生活环境。